THE PRELUDE

THE PROCESSIONAL - Holy! Holy! Holy1 Hymnal #25, Verse 1

THE Prayer of Consecration

Minister: Almighty God, unto who all hearts are open, all desires known, and from whom no secrets are hid:
Cleanse the thoughts of our hearts by the inspiration of Thy Holy Spirit, that we may perfectly love Thee, and worthily magnify Thy Holy Name; through Christ Jesus, our Lord. AMEN.

THE PROCESSIONAL continued - Holy! Holy! Holy1, Verse 2

The Doxology

Minister & Congregation Praise God from whom all blessings flow
Praise Him all creatures here below.
Praise Him above ye heavenly host
Praise Father, Son, and Holy Ghost. AMEN

The Call to Worship

Psalm 16 -A Song of David.
Minister: 1 Preserve me, O God, for in You I put my trust.
People: 2 O my soul, you have said to the LORD, “You are my Lord, My goodness is nothing apart from You.”
Minister: 3 As for the saints who are on the earth, “They are the excellent ones, in whom is all my delight.”
People: 4 Their sorrows shall be multiplied who hasten after another god; Their drink offerings of blood I will not offer, Nor take up their names on my lips.
Minister: 5 O LORD, You are the portion of my inheritance and my cup; You maintain my lot.
People: 6 The lines have fallen to me in pleasant places; Yes, I have a good inheritance.
Minister: 7 I will bless the LORD who has given me counsel; My heart also instructs me in the night seasons.
People: 8 I have set the LORD always before me; Because He is at my right hand I shall not be moved.
Minister: 9 Therefore my heart is glad, and my glory rejoices; My flesh also will rest in hope.
People:: 10 For You will not leave my soul in Sheol, Nor will You allow Your Holy One to see corruption.
ALL: 11 You will show me the path of life; In Your presence is fullness of joy; At Your right hand are pleasures forevermore.

On behalf of the members of Macedonia AME Church I want to welcome you to the Church and thank you for worshipping with us. We pray that you have been blessed by your experience with the Lord at our Church home.  Feel free to take this bulletin with you.  We have been blessed by your presence here today. 

As you may have noticed, after the message, we make the Invitation to Christian Discipleship. This is the opportunity for those who have not accepted Christ as Savior or who are not sure about their personal salvation to come forward and accept Christ.  If you need additional information of have questions regarding what this means, do not hesitate to contact Pastor Paris or a member of the church immediately after the benediction.
